Add 49/54 and 28/27

1st number: 49/54, 2nd number: 1 1/27

49/54 + 28/27 is 35/18.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 54 and 27 is 54

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 54
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 54 × 1 = 54,
    49/54 = 49 × 1/54 × 1 = 49/54
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 27 × 2 = 54,
    28/27 = 28 × 2/27 × 2 = 56/54
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    49/54 + 56/54 = 49 + 56/54 = 105/54
  5. 105/54 simplified gives 35/18
  6. So, 49/54 + 28/27 = 35/18
